She will choose option A.
Step-by-step explanation:
Option A : 2 Years in Community college and 2 years in University
Option B : 4 Years in University
Per year cost in Community college = $2900 + $800 +$1250 = $4950
Per year cost for University = $9500+$10000 + $11500 + 2000 = $32000
Total cost for 4 years as per option A = 2 ( Community College) + 2(University)
= 2( $4950) + 2( $32000)
= $ 73900
Total cost for 4 years as per option B = 4(University)
= 4( $32000)
= $ 128000
Hence, she will choose option A due to minimum cost.
